Europe's Turkish Awakening
by Burak Bekdil
cLJgwwTAvNvHZlzS0o2kqpjkhCfLaKsVuFGLKrtOixga_cai_aI7JZPUzEgEfjfD2eXmH1dCLlrn1kMJPM2OFw=s0-d-e1-ft#%3Ca%20rel%3Dnofollow%20href=
Dutch police contain a riot that broke out in Rotterdam
{meforum.org} ~ Turkey, officially, is a candidate for full membership in the European Union. It is also negotiating with Brussels a deal that would allow millions of Turks to travel to Europe without visa... But Turkey is not like any other European country that joined or will join the EU: The Turks' choice of a leader, in office since 2002, too visibly makes this country the odd one out.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an, who is now campaigning to broaden his constitutional powers, which would make him head of state, head of government and head of the ruling party -- all at the same time -- is inherently autocratic and anti-Western. He seems to view himself as a great Muslim leader fighting armies of infidel crusaders. This image with which he portrays himself finds powerful echoes among millions of conservative Turks and Sunni Islamists across the Middle East. That, among other excesses in the Turkish style, makes Turkey totally incompatible with Europe in political culture...  http://www.meforum.org/6594/europe-turkish-awakening?utm_source=Middle+East+Forum&utm_campaign=61755d9ee5-bekdil_burak_2017_03_15&utm_medium=email&utm_term=0_086cfd423c-61755d9ee5-33703665&goal=0_086cfd423c-61755d9ee5-33703665

Trump Strikes Al-Qaeda More in One Month
Than liar-nObama Did in Any Year
by Edwin Mora
bTXGi1ALrSBWvMh1jm30v58rmaHc4p0hQ_tilA_9JxcMP2z6HCCPlVd39ry3Orst3rYthvEz0wlAcpCuhwJ2VKLUDsKVTdQlWjMX3HW7DeMrowmNFaT-L5M=s0-d-e1-ft#%3Ca%20rel%3Dnofollow%20href=
{breitbart.com} ~ The number of U.S. military airstrikes against al-Qaeda in Yemen so far this month have surpassed those that occurred during any year under former President Barack liar-nObama’s presidency... In just the first days of March, the U.S. military under President Donald Trump’s watch struck 40 targets in Yemen linked to al-Qaeda in the Arabian Peninsula (AQAP), reports Foreign Policy (FP), adding: The weeklong blitz in Yemen eclipsed the annual bombing total for any year during liar-nObama’s presidency. Under the previous administration, approval for strikes came only after slow-moving policy discussions, with senior officials required to sign off on any action. The Trump administration has proven much quicker at green-lighting attacks...  http://www.breitbart.com/national-security/2017/03/16/yemen-trump-strikes-al-qaeda-more-one-month-obama-any-year/
